About this map

Apex and the adjacent industrial site of Arrolime occupy a prominent position along the transportation corridors northeast of North Las Vegas. This high-desert landscape is defined by the Mojave Desert terrain, where the elevation rises toward Apex Summit. The map documents a critical junction of modern infrastructure and historical routes, including the Old Spanish Trail Rd and Las Vegas Blvd N, cutting through the dry landscape of the Gale Hills. Drainage patterns are marked by Gypsum Wash, which carries seasonal runoff across the arid flats. The arrangement of settlements like Dike and the network of heavy-duty thoroughfares such as Nadine Petersen Blvd reflect the area's development as an industrial and logistical hub for the Las Vegas valley.
